Handling Pain and Pain



You need to take over-the-counter pain drug to help handle any type of discomfort you might experience after your oral implant treatment. It's common to experience some level of pain or pain complying with the surgery. Taking non-prescription discomfort medicine, such as advil or acetaminophen, can help ease any post-operative pain. Furthermore, applying an ice pack to the affected area for 15 mins each time can help reduce swelling and give short-term alleviation. It is very important to relax and prevent strenuous tasks for the initial few days to allow your body to heal.

Bear in mind to deal with on your own and prioritize your recovery during this time around.

Oral Hygiene and Cleansing Techniques



Preserving proper oral hygiene and on a regular basis cleansing your dental implant are vital for a successful recuperation.

After getting an oral implant, it is very important to comply with appropriate oral health practices to ensure the long life and wellness of your implant. Be mild around the dental implant location to stay clear of creating any kind of damage.

In addition, flossing is crucial to eliminate plaque and food particles that can build up around the dental implant. Utilize a floss threader or interdental brush to tidy between the implant and adjacent teeth.

In addition, washing with an antimicrobial mouthwash can help in reducing bacteria and keep oral health.

Routine dental examinations and professional cleansings are likewise needed to check the condition of your oral implant and resolve any type of prospective concerns.

Dietary Considerations and Restrictions



When it comes to your diet plan after getting an oral implant, it's important to be mindful of particular considerations and restrictions. While you might aspire to go back to your normal consuming routines, it's critical to provide your dental implant time to heal appropriately.

In the initial couple of days after surgical procedure, you should stick to a soft or fluid diet plan to stay clear of putting way too much stress on the implant site. This implies preventing hard, crispy, or sticky foods that can possibly remove or harm the implant. It's likewise recommended to avoid warm foods and drinks, as they can increase pain and swelling.

As your implant heals, you can slowly reestablish solid foods, however beware and chew on the opposite side of your mouth to avoid any unneeded pressure on the dental implant. Bear in mind to adhere to any type of particular dietary instructions given by your dental professional and speak with them if you have any kind of issues.
